Cody Rhodes has discovered the identity of his first challenger.

Now that Cody Rhodes has finally “finished the story” and beaten Roman Reigns the big question is, what next?

At Backlash on May 4th, Rhodes will put the title on the line against a new challenger, who just so happens to be someone he’s never wrestled before.

On the April 19th episode of SmackDown, AJ Styles pinned LA Knight to book himself a shot at Rhodes and World Title glory. A week earlier, Styles overcame Kevin Owens and Rey Mysterio, while Knight got the better of Bobby Lashley and Santos Escobar.

The match between Styles and Rhodes is especially notable as it’s the first time the former Bullet Club stars have met in the ring. While the Phenomenal One has a championship pedigree in WWE he hasn’t held the gold since late 2018.

Cody Rhodes Eyeing Showdown With The Rock

During WWE’s recent UK tour, Rhodes made several media appearances, most notably on Good Morning Britain. While on the show, Cody Rhodes discussed a potential showdown with The Rock. The pair became involved in a heated rivalry going into WrestleMania, and a head-to-head on Raw only added to the speculation.

Looking ahead, The American Nightmare said he hopes the match can happen, but a lot will depend on him being a “good champion.’

Meanwhile, The Rock recently took the opportunity to send another warning to Rhodes, closing by saying he’ll “see him down the road.”
